The youth movement is underway for the Aberdeen Roncalli girls’ golf team. The Cavaliers have five players out for the sport this spring: one eighth-grader and four seventh-graders. “Out of those five, I have four of them that play in that Junior PGA, so we have some pretty good experience with them,” said Roncalli coach Kerry Brandenburger. “They’ve got lots of good experience and they play every summer in those tournaments. There’s a lot of good experience, young experience, but very good.” Because of their golf background, Brandenburger said it isn’t like starting from ground zero. “You don’t have to spend a whole lot of time on teaching them how to hold a club, the swing aspect of it,” she said. “We get to do a little bit more course management, fine tune some of those things.
